Cork Facts and Basics<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ork flooring is a flooring option made from the bark of the cork oak tree (Quercus suber). The bark regenerates naturally, allowing cork to be harvested repeatedly without damaging the tree. This harvesting process is one of the key reasons cork is widely recognized as a sustainable building material.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"What_Cork_Flooring_Is_Made_Of\"><\/span>What Cork Flooring Is Made Of<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>A cork floor is created from the bark of the cork oak, combined with a natural wax called suberin that gives cork its flexibility and water resistance. Heat and pressure are then applied to bind cork granules together into dense surface cork layers. Because cork is harvested only from the outer bark, it remains a renewable resource and one of the most environmentally friendly floor materials available.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_Cork_Flooring_Differs_From_Solid_Hardwood\"><\/span>How Cork Flooring Differs From Solid Hardwood<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Unlike hardwood flooring, cork has a cellular structure filled with millions of tiny air pockets. These cells allow cork to compress under pressure and rebound once the weight is removed. This structure creates a noticeably softer feel underfoot, especially with each foot for a floating floor system. It also provides better noise absorption than wood flooring and offers natural insulation properties not found in ceramic or stone tile.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_Cork_Flooring_Is_Made_Flooring_Made_Step_by_Step\"><\/span>How Cork Flooring Is Made (Flooring Made Step by Step)<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Harvesting_Cork_Without_Cutting_Trees\"><\/span>Harvesting Cork Without Cutting Trees<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ork is harvested by hand every nine years. The tree remains alive throughout the process and actually grows stronger with each harvest cycle. This method makes cork one of the few flooring products that improves forest health over time while supporting long-term environmental balance.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Processing_and_Granulation\"><\/span>Processing and Granulation<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>After harvest, cork bark is air-dried and then ground into granules or cork dust. These granules are sorted by density and size to ensure consistent quality. Some cork products rely on natural binders, while others use resin-assisted binding to increase stability, especially in demanding flooring applications.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Forming_Cork_Flooring_Panels\"><\/span>Forming Cork Flooring Panels<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Once prepared, the granulated cork is compressed under heat to form solid slabs. These slabs are then cut into tiles and planks, including modern cork flooring planks, depending on the intended flooring application and installation method.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Finishing_Layers_and_Surface_Treatments\"><\/span>Finishing Layers and Surface Treatments<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Modern cork flooring includes a protective outer layer that protects cork from everyday wear. UV-cured finishes and optional sealants are added to improve durability and moisture resistance. These finishes directly affect how well the floor resists scratches, stains, and water exposure, which is important because cork is prone to surface damage if left unprotected.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Types_of_Cork_Flooring_Two_Types_of_Cork_Flooring\"><\/span>Types of Cork Flooring (Two Types of Cork Flooring)<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Natural_Cork_Flooring\"><\/span>Natural Cork Flooring<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Natural cork flooring is a single-layer product made entirely from cork. It offers a warm, natural look and feel, but is more sensitive to moisture and direct sunlight. Without proper sealing or UV protection, cork is prone to fading over time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Engineered_Cork_Flooring\"><\/span>Engineered Cork Flooring<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Engineered cork flooring uses multiple layers to improve structural stability. This construction makes cork more durable and better able to handle temperature changes, making it a reliable option for a wider range of environments.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Floating_Cork_Flooring_Floating_Floor_Systems\"><\/span>Floating Cork Flooring (Floating Floor Systems)<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>A floating cork floor uses click-lock joints and installs without adhesive. These cork floating floors include a built-in underlayment and are popular for DIY projects because they install quickly and provide excellent comfort underfoot.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>(Internal link opportunity: floating floor installation guide)<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Glue-Down_Cork_Tiles\"><\/span>Glue-Down Cork Tiles<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Glue-down cork flooring adheres directly to the subfloor. These glue-down tiles are commonly used in commercial flooring applications, where stability is critical. This installation method also allows the floor to be refinished over time, extending its lifespan.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Cork_Flooring_Composition_Breakdown\"><\/span>Cork Flooring Composition Breakdown<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Core_Structure_Explained\"><\/span>Core Structure Explained<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The core of cork flooring is made up of millions of air-filled cells. These cells provide shock absorption, thermal insulation, and acoustic control. Together, these characteristics make cork a durable flooring choice for living spaces, apartments, and multi-story buildings.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Wear_Layer_and_Protective_Finishes\"><\/span>Wear Layer and Protective Finishes<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Thicker wear layers improve resistance to scratches, help maintain the floor\u2019s appearance over time, and make it easier to maintain cork floors with routine cleaning and care.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Cork_Flooring_Performance_Characteristics\"><\/span>Cork Flooring Performance Characteristics<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Comfort_and_Underfoot_Feel\"><\/span>Comfort and Underfoot Feel<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ork is noticeably softer than vinyl flooring or ceramic tiles. This softness reduces joint fatigue and makes cork comfortable for standing areas like kitchens. The natural cushioning effect is one of the key reasons cork offers superior comfort compared to harder flooring materials.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Durability_and_Life_Span\"><\/span>Durability and Life Span<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>A well-maintained cork floor can last for decades. Cork is a durable option for most residential settings, although sharp impacts can leave dents because cork is prone to compression under heavy point loads.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Water_and_Moisture_Behavior\"><\/span>Water and Moisture Behavior<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ork is considered water-resistant flooring but not fully waterproof. When properly sealed, cork performs well in kitchens because cork is naturally resistant to moisture penetration. However, it is not suitable for areas with standing water.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Temperature_and_Thermal_Insulation\"><\/span>Temperature and Thermal Insulation<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ork naturally regulates temperature and works well with radiant heating systems when installed correctly. This helps maintain a consistent indoor environment throughout the year.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Sound_Absorption_and_Noise_Reduction\"><\/span>Sound Absorption and Noise Reduction<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ork reduces impact noise more effectively than vinyl tile or hardwood. This makes it an excellent choice for condos, apartments, and upper floors where sound control is important.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Pros_and_Cons_of_Cork_Flooring\"><\/span>Pros and Cons of Cork Flooring<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Advantages_and_Benefits_of_Cork_Flooring\"><\/span>Advantages and Benefits of Cork Flooring<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The main benefits of cork flooring include comfort, thermal insulation, sustainability, and sound control. Each offers different benefits depending on budget, durability, and design preferences.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Frequently_Asked_Questions_About_Cork_Flooring\"><\/span>Frequently Asked Questions About Cork Flooring<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"What_is_cork_flooring_made_of\"><\/span>What is cork flooring made of?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ork flooring is made from the bark of the cork oak tree (Quercus suber), which is harvested without cutting down the tree. The bark is ground into granules, compressed under heat and pressure, and formed into tiles or planks. Natural suberin in cork provides flexibility, insulation, and water resistance.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_is_cork_flooring_made_step_by_step\"><\/span>How is cork flooring made step by step?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ork flooring is made by harvesting cork bark every nine years, air-drying it, grinding it into granules, compressing it into slabs, cutting it into tiles or planks, and applying protective finishes. This process creates durable cork flooring panels while keeping the cork oak tree alive and renewable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Is_cork_flooring_durable_for_long-term_use\"><\/span>Is cork flooring durable for long-term use?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Yes. Cork flooring is durable and can last 25 to 40 years when properly installed and maintained. Its cellular structure allows it to compress and rebound under pressure, making it resistant to cracks. However, heavy point loads or sharp objects can cause dents if the surface is not protected.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Is_cork_flooring_waterproof_or_just_water-resistant\"><\/span>Is cork flooring waterproof or just water-resistant?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ork flooring is water-resistant but not fully waterproof. When sealed with a protective finish, cork can handle moisture exposure in kitchens and living areas. However, standing water or excessive humidity can damage unsealed cork flooring over time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Is_cork_flooring_good_for_pets\"><\/span>Is cork flooring good for pets?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ork absorbs impact well, but cork is prone to scratching from sharp claws.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Is_cork_flooring_environmentally_friendly\"><\/span>Is cork flooring environmentally friendly?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Cork flooring is considered one of the most environmentally friendly flooring materials because it is harvested from renewable bark without cutting down the tree. Cork oak forests absorb significant amounts of CO\u2082 and regenerate naturally, making cork a sustainable flooring choice.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Cork flooring is not a trend.
